Abu Dhabi now has a direct route to the Etihad Rails station as it expanded its public transport network with the launch of two new bus routes, which made it a lot easier for the residents and visitors there to access the UAE’s national passenger rail service.
The people in charge, at the Integrated Transport Centre also known as Abu Dhabi Mobility shared this plan. The main goal of Abu Dhabi Mobility is to make it easy for people to get to the Etihad Rail station. The emirate is also ready to start using the rail for passengers. The new bus services will help people move smoothly between buses and trains. This should make more people use transport instead of driving their own cars.
The new routes will link places where people live and where they can catch other forms of transport with the Etihad Rail station. This helps passengers move around Abu Dhabi quickly. In the future these routes will also connect to places that are served by the growing railway system in the UAE. Officials said the bus schedules have been coordinated with anticipated passenger demand to ensure smoother journeys and convenient transfers.

The move forms part of Abu Dhabi’s broader strategy to develop an integrated and sustainable transport system. By strengthening links between different modes of public transport, authorities aim to improve mobility, reduce traffic congestion and support environmental goals through lower vehicle emissions.
Abu Dhabi Mobility said the new routes are equipped with modern buses featuring accessible facilities and passenger amenities designed to provide a comfortable travel experience. Real-time service information will also be available through official digital platforms, enabling commuters to plan their journeys more effectively.
The expansion comes as the UAE advances work on its national railway network, which is expected to transform inter-emirate travel by providing faster and more sustainable transport options. Passenger rail services will eventually connect major cities and communities across the country, offering an alternative to road travel while supporting economic growth and tourism.
Transport officials have encouraged residents to explore the new bus services and incorporate public transport into their daily commutes. The additional routes are expected to improve accessibility to the Etihad Rail station and play an important role in creating a more connected transport ecosystem for Abu Dhabi.
